AI Summary

  • Creates the Low-Income Water Residential Affordability Program to cap water bills at 2-3% of household income for residential customers at or below 200% of federal poverty guidelines, or those receiving SNAP, Medicaid, SSI, WIC, or energy assistance

  • Provides automatic arrearage forgiveness of up to $1,500 upon enrollment, with additional $1,500 forgiven after 12 months of timely payments, and full remaining arrearage forgiveness after 24 months of participation

  • Establishes monthly water use limits tied to household size (6-8 centum cubic feet for 1-4 people, scaling up to 18-20 for 11+ people), with normal rates charged for usage exceeding these limits

  • Allows providers to develop their own low-income water affordability programs meeting equivalent criteria, or opt out of the state funding factor if they create and fund their own program

  • Requires implementation 18 months after fund collection begins for providers with 500+ connections, with all providers covered 18 months later; includes up to $2,500 for household plumbing repairs for eligible homeowners

Legislative Description

Human services: services or financial assistance; water rate affordability program; create. Amends 1939 PA 280 (MCL 400.1 - 400.119b) by adding secs. 14n, 14o, 14p, 14r, 14s & 14u. TIE BAR WITH: SB 0248'25, SB 0252'25, SB 0249'25
